Raise Cain rallied from far back to win the 2023 Gotham Stakes (G3) at Aqueduct, a prep race for the 2023 Kentucky Derby (G1) worth 50 points to the winner. Is the Ben Colebrook-trained Violence colt becoming a sneaky Kentucky Derby long shot horse? Tell us YOUR thoughts in the Comments section!
